Evaluating Your Financial Status

Stressed individual overwhelmed by gambling debts, bills, and casino chips at a dimly lit desk

Begin your journey towards consolidating gambling-related debts by compiling a detailed list of all your current financial obligations. This list should encompass the amounts owed, interest rates, and any additional fees linked to each debt. Gaining a comprehensive view of your financial landscape is crucial. It enables you to assess your overall financial health and pinpoint which debts are exerting the most pressure on your resources.

After gathering this information, calculate your total debt. Include both the principal amounts and the interest rates applicable to each obligation within the United Kingdom. Being aware of these figures will empower you to make educated decisions regarding potential consolidation strategies, ensuring you fully comprehend your financial commitments before proceeding.

Knowing Your Legal Rights in Debt Consolidation

Understanding your rights under UK financial regulations is essential when consolidating debts. The FCA enforces various consumer protections to ensure fair treatment throughout the debt consolidation process. For instance, lenders must conduct affordability assessments before granting loans, shielding you from excessive repayment burdens.

Being informed about these legal protections empowers you as a borrower. If you suspect a lender is not adhering to these regulations, you have the right to raise your concerns with the FCA or seek advice from a financial advisor. This knowledge can help safeguard your interests and guarantee a fair consolidation process.

Understanding Debt Management Plans

Debt management plans (DMPs) present another viable option for individuals grappling with gambling debts in the UK. These plans involve collaborating with authorised firms that negotiate with creditors on your behalf, often resulting in reduced payments. This can be particularly advantageous if you are managing multiple high-interest debts that feel overwhelming.

A DMP consolidates your debts into a single monthly payment, simplifying the tracking of your financial responsibilities. With a professional overseeing your debts, you may find that the stress of negotiating with creditors diminishes significantly, allowing you to concentrate on your recovery.

Utilising Balance Transfer Credit Cards

Balance transfer credit cards can offer a temporary solution for managing gambling debts. Many UK credit cards provide introductory zero per cent interest rates for a specified duration, enabling you to transfer existing debts without incurring additional interest. This strategy can be beneficial while you work on a more sustainable long-term consolidation plan.

When using balance transfer options, it is crucial to comprehend the associated terms and conditions. Be mindful of any fees linked to the transfer and the duration of the zero per cent interest period. Understanding these details will assist you in planning your repayments effectively and avoiding a return to debt once the promotional period concludes.

Considering Remortgaging Your Home

Remortgaging your property can be an effective strategy for consolidating gambling debts. By accessing equity from your home, you can settle multiple high-interest debts with a single consolidated payment, often at a lower interest rate. This method can substantially reduce your overall interest burden and simplify your financial commitments.

Before proceeding with remortgaging, consult with authorised lenders to explore your options. It is essential to comprehend the implications of remortgaging, including potential fees and the impact on your monthly mortgage payments. This informed approach guarantees you make decisions that bolster your long-term financial stability.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does debt consolidation involve?

Debt consolidation means merging multiple debts into a single payment, usually at a lower interest rate. This method can simplify repayment and potentially lower overall interest costs.

How can I evaluate my gambling-related debts?

Begin by listing all outstanding debts, including amounts owed and interest rates. This will provide a clear overview of your financial situation.

Is debt consolidation suitable for everyone?

Not everyone is a fit for debt consolidation. It is crucial to assess your income stability and existing credit agreements before determining whether it is the right choice for you.

What documentation is required for debt consolidation?

You will need payslips, bank statements, and details about your creditors. These documents assist lenders in assessing your financial situation.

How can professional advisors aid in debt consolidation?

Professional advisors offer customised advice, help you explore various options, and guide you through the consolidation process to ensure optimal outcomes.

What risks are associated with debt consolidation?

Risks include potentially higher overall costs if a longer repayment term is selected and the possibility of accruing more debt if spending habits do not change.

Can I consolidate debts without a good credit score?

Yes, but options may be limited. You might need to consider secured loans or seek assistance from specialised lenders familiar with gambling-related debts.

What are debt management plans?

Debt management plans are arrangements with creditors to lower payments and consolidate debts into a single monthly payment, often facilitated by an authorised firm.

How long does the debt consolidation process take?

The duration varies based on the chosen method and the lender’s requirements. It can take anywhere from a few weeks to several months to complete.

Are there government resources available for debt management?

Yes, the MoneyHelper website offers tools and guides for managing debts, including calculators and educational resources designed for UK residents.
